Gibson Recipe

A Martini gone savory β€” ice-cold vodka and dry vermouth finished with a briny cocktail onion. A Martini variation garnished with a cocktail onion instead of an olive, documented in cocktail books since the early 20th century.

Ingredients

  • 2.5 oz Vodka (kept in the freezer if possible)
  • 0.5 oz Dry vermouth
  • 1 tsp Cocktail onion brine (optional, for a dirtier Gibson)
  • Cocktail onion on a pick, for garnish

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Chill a coupe glass in the freezer.
  2. Add vodka, vermouth, and brine if using to a mixing glass with ice.
  3. Stir 20-30 seconds until ice-cold.
  4. Strain into the chilled coupe.
  5. Garnish with a cocktail onion on a pick.

Pro Tips and Variations

Keep the vodka in the freezer and skip the brine on the first try; the onion alone gives plenty of savor.

Frequently Asked Questions

Gibson vs Martini?

Same build, different garnish. The cocktail onion replaces olive or twist and pushes the drink savory.
